@charset "UTF-8";:root{font-family:system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;line-height:1.5;font-weight:400;color-scheme:dark;color:#fff;background-color:#000;font-synthesis:none;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}body{margin:0;min-width:320px;min-height:100vh;background-color:#000}#root{width:100%;min-height:100vh}a{text-decoration:none}html{scroll-behavior:smooth}._nav_1xmna_4{position:relative;z-index:200;height:100px;width:100%;background:#000;color:#fff;display:flex;align-items:center;justify-content:space-between;padding-inline:clamp(48px,10vw,96px);box-sizing:border-box}._leftGroup_1xmna_22{display:flex;align-items:center;gap:clamp(24px,4vw,44px);min-width:0}._logo_1xmna_29{display:flex;align-items:center}._logo_1xmna_29 img{height:80px;width:auto;display:block}._links_1xmna_40{display:flex;align-items:center;flex-wrap:nowrap;gap:clamp(18px,3.2vw,38px)}._links_1xmna_40 a{color:#fff;text-decoration:none;font-size:.95rem;font-weight:500;white-space:nowrap;transition:opacity .2s ease}._links_1xmna_40 a:hover{opacity:.7}._rightGroup_1xmna_62{display:flex;align-items:center;gap:clamp(18px,3vw,34px);flex-shrink:0}._rightGroup_1xmna_62 a{display:inline-flex;align-items:center;justify-content:center;width:42px;height:42px;border-radius:999px;color:#fff;text-decoration:none;font-size:1.5rem;transition:background .2s ease,transform .15s ease,opacity .2s ease}._rightGroup_1xmna_62 a:hover{background:#ffffff1f;transform:translateY(-1px)}._rightGroup_1xmna_62 a:active{transform:translateY(0);opacity:.8}._burgerButton_1xmna_93{display:none;background:transparent;border:none;color:#fff;cursor:pointer;width:40px;height:40px;align-items:center;justify-content:center;font-size:1.8rem;padding:0}._mobileMenu_1xmna_110{position:fixed;inset:0;background:#000;z-index:100;display:flex;flex-direction:column;gap:20px;padding-top:120px;padding-inline:clamp(48px,10vw,96px);padding-bottom:32px;box-sizing:border-box}._mobileMenu_1xmna_110 a{color:#fff;text-decoration:none;font-size:1.05rem;font-weight:500;padding-block:6px;transition:opacity .2s ease}._mobileMenu_1xmna_110 a:hover{opacity:.7}@media(max-width:1300px){._nav_1xmna_4{height:80px}._links_1xmna_40,._rightGroup_1xmna_62{display:none}._burgerButton_1xmna_93{display:inline-flex}._logo_1xmna_29{font-size:1.15rem}}._about_1lf15_1{background:#000;color:#fff;padding-inline:clamp(48px,10vw,96px);padding-top:clamp(100px,15vw,180px);padding-bottom:clamp(80px,12vw,140px);box-sizing:border-box}._title_1lf15_12{font-size:clamp(2rem,6vw,4.5rem);font-weight:800;margin:0 0 28px;letter-spacing:.03em}._description_1lf15_20{max-width:900px;line-height:1.65;opacity:.85;font-size:clamp(.95rem,1.4vw,1.25rem)}._games_14qal_1{background:#000;color:#fff;padding-inline:clamp(48px,10vw,96px);padding-top:clamp(80px,12vw,140px);padding-bottom:clamp(80px,12vw,140px);box-sizing:border-box}._cards_14qal_10{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:clamp(24px,3vw,40px)}@media(max-width:900px){._cards_14qal_10{grid-template-columns:1fr}}._card_epsgl_1{background:#050505;border-radius:16px;padding:20px 20px 24px;box-sizing:border-box;border:1px solid rgba(255,255,255,.08);display:flex;flex-direction:column;gap:16px;overflow:hidden}._imageWrapper_epsgl_15{border-radius:12px;overflow:hidden;background:#111;transform:translateZ(0)}._imagePlaceholder_epsgl_22{position:relative;width:100%;aspect-ratio:16/9;border-radius:0;overflow:hidden;line-height:0;font-size:0;background:linear-gradient(135deg,#222,#444)}._image_epsgl_15{position:absolute;inset:0;width:100%;height:100%;object-fit:cover;display:block;backface-visibility:hidden;transform:scale(1) translateZ(0);transform-origin:center;will-change:transform;transition:transform .35s ease}._imageWrapper_epsgl_15:hover ._image_epsgl_15{transform:scale(1.06) translateZ(0)}._titleRow_epsgl_53{display:flex;align-items:center;justify-content:space-between;gap:12px;flex-wrap:nowrap;min-width:0}._cardTitle_epsgl_62{margin:0;min-width:0;flex:1;font-size:clamp(1.3rem,2.4vw,1.8rem);font-weight:700;line-height:1.3;display:-webkit-box;-webkit-box-orient:vertical;line-clamp:1;overflow:hidden}._status_epsgl_77{flex-shrink:0;white-space:nowrap;display:inline-flex;align-items:center;justify-content:center;font-size:.8rem;font-weight:700;letter-spacing:.03em;padding:6px 10px;border-radius:999px;border:1px solid rgba(255,255,255,.18);opacity:.95;line-height:1;box-sizing:border-box}._released_epsgl_94,._inDev_epsgl_99{background:#ffffff14;border-color:#ffffff38}._cardActions_epsgl_105{display:flex;gap:12px;flex-wrap:nowrap;min-width:0}._primaryButton_epsgl_113,._secondaryButton_epsgl_114{display:inline-flex;align-items:center;justify-content:center;text-decoration:none;font-family:inherit;font-size:.95rem;font-weight:600;line-height:1;padding:.7rem 1.2rem;border-radius:10px;border:1px solid rgba(255,255,255,.9);cursor:pointer;box-sizing:border-box;transition:transform .12s ease,opacity .18s ease,background .18s ease;flex:0 0 auto;white-space:nowrap}._primaryButton_epsgl_113{background:#fff;color:#000}._primaryButton_epsgl_113:hover{opacity:.92;transform:translateY(-1px)}._primaryButton_epsgl_113:active{transform:translateY(0)}._secondaryButton_epsgl_114{background:transparent;color:#fff;border-color:#ffffff73}._secondaryButton_epsgl_114:hover{background:#ffffff1f;transform:translateY(-1px)}._secondaryButton_epsgl_114:active{transform:translateY(0)}._cardDescription_epsgl_161{margin:0;font-size:clamp(.95rem,1.2vw,1.05rem);line-height:1.6;opacity:.85}@media(max-width:600px){._titleRow_epsgl_53{flex-direction:column;align-items:stretch;gap:10px}._cardTitle_epsgl_62{line-clamp:2;text-align:left}._status_epsgl_77{width:100%;border-radius:12px;padding:.85rem 1.2rem}._cardActions_epsgl_105{width:100%;flex-direction:column;flex-wrap:nowrap;gap:12px}._primaryButton_epsgl_113,._secondaryButton_epsgl_114{width:100%;display:flex;border-radius:12px;padding:.85rem 1.2rem}}@media(prefers-reduced-motion:reduce){._image_epsgl_15,._primaryButton_epsgl_113,._secondaryButton_epsgl_114{transition:none}._imageWrapper_epsgl_15:hover ._image_epsgl_15{transform:none}}._developers_sufo9_1{background:#000;color:#fff;padding-inline:clamp(48px,10vw,96px);padding-top:clamp(80px,12vw,140px);padding-bottom:clamp(80px,12vw,140px);box-sizing:border-box}._title_sufo9_11{font-size:clamp(2rem,6vw,4.5rem);font-weight:800;margin:0 0 40px;letter-spacing:.03em}._cards_sufo9_19{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:clamp(24px,3vw,40px)}@media(max-width:1000px){._cards_sufo9_19{grid-template-columns:repeat(2,1fr)}}@media(max-width:700px){._cards_sufo9_19{grid-template-columns:1fr}}._card_1yhrn_1{background:#050505;border-radius:16px;padding:24px 28px;box-sizing:border-box;border:1px solid rgba(255,255,255,.08);display:flex;flex-direction:column;gap:14px}._name_1yhrn_12{font-size:clamp(1.6rem,3vw,2.2rem);font-weight:700;margin:0}._role_1yhrn_18{font-size:clamp(1rem,1.6vw,1.3rem);font-weight:500;margin:0;opacity:.85}._description_1yhrn_25{margin:0;font-size:clamp(.95rem,1.3vw,1.1rem);line-height:1.6;opacity:.85}._contact_8s854_3{background:#000;color:#fff;padding-inline:clamp(48px,10vw,96px);padding-top:clamp(80px,12vw,140px);padding-bottom:clamp(80px,12vw,140px);box-sizing:border-box;display:flex;flex-direction:column;align-items:center}._title_8s854_15{font-size:clamp(2rem,5vw,3rem);font-weight:800;margin-bottom:32px;text-align:center}._form_8s854_22{width:100%;max-width:600px;display:flex;flex-direction:column;gap:20px;align-items:center}._fieldGroup_8s854_31{width:100%;display:flex;flex-direction:column;gap:6px}._label_8s854_38{font-size:.9rem;opacity:.9}._input_8s854_43,._textarea_8s854_44{width:100%;background:#050505;border-radius:10px;border:1px solid rgba(255,255,255,.2);color:#fff;padding:10px 12px;font:inherit;box-sizing:border-box;outline:none;transition:border-color .18s ease,box-shadow .18s ease}._textarea_8s854_44{min-height:140px;resize:vertical}._errorText_8s854_62{color:#ff6b6b;font-size:.9rem;text-align:center;margin:0}._sendButton_8s854_70{margin-top:10px;padding:.75rem 1.8rem;border-radius:999px;border:1px solid #fff;background:#fff;color:#000;font-size:.95rem;font-weight:600;cursor:pointer;align-self:center;transition:opacity .18s ease,transform .12s ease}._sendButton_8s854_70:hover:not(:disabled){opacity:.9;transform:translateY(-1px)}._sentState_8s854_89{min-height:320px;width:100%;max-width:600px;display:flex;flex-direction:column;align-items:center;justify-content:center;text-align:center;gap:14px;animation:_sentFadeUp_8s854_1 .65s ease both}@keyframes _sentFadeUp_8s854_1{0%{opacity:0;transform:translateY(14px)}to{opacity:1;transform:translateY(0)}}._checkWrap_8s854_112{width:280px;height:280px;border-radius:999px;display:grid;place-items:center;background:#3dd68c14;border:2px solid rgba(61,214,140,.35);box-shadow:0 0 0 28px #3dd68c0a;animation:_checkPop_8s854_1 .52s ease both}@keyframes _checkPop_8s854_1{0%{transform:scale(.92)}60%{transform:scale(1.04)}to{transform:scale(1)}}._checkSvg_8s854_136{width:186px;height:186px}._checkCircle_8s854_142{fill:none;stroke:#3dd68ca6;stroke-width:4;stroke-dasharray:155;stroke-dashoffset:155;animation:_drawCircle_8s854_1 .7s ease forwards}@keyframes _drawCircle_8s854_1{to{stroke-dashoffset:0}}._checkPath_8s854_157{fill:none;stroke:#3dd68c;stroke-width:6;stroke-linecap:round;stroke-linejoin:round;stroke-dasharray:60;stroke-dashoffset:60;animation:_drawCheck_8s854_1 .52s .32s ease forwards}@keyframes _drawCheck_8s854_1{to{stroke-dashoffset:0}}._sentTitle_8s854_173{margin:10px 0 0;font-size:clamp(1.4rem,2.4vw,1.9rem);font-weight:800;letter-spacing:.02em}._sentText_8s854_180{margin:0;max-width:520px;font-size:clamp(1rem,1.5vw,1.15rem);line-height:1.6;opacity:.85}@media(prefers-reduced-motion:reduce){._sentState_8s854_89,._checkWrap_8s854_112,._checkCircle_8s854_142,._checkPath_8s854_157{animation:none!important}._checkCircle_8s854_142,._checkPath_8s854_157{stroke-dashoffset:0}}._footer_12hgp_1{background:#fff;color:#000;width:100%}._inner_12hgp_8{padding-inline:clamp(80px,14vw,200px);padding-top:clamp(70px,8vw,100px);padding-bottom:clamp(50px,6vw,80px);display:grid;grid-template-columns:1.4fr 1fr;gap:clamp(24px,4vw,56px);align-items:start;box-sizing:border-box}@media(max-width:900px){._inner_12hgp_8{grid-template-columns:1fr;gap:48px}}._left_12hgp_27{display:flex;flex-direction:column;gap:20px}._logo_12hgp_33{display:flex;align-items:center}._logo_12hgp_33 img{height:250px;width:auto;display:block}._blurb_12hgp_43{margin:0;max-width:560px;line-height:1.6;opacity:.85}._socials_12hgp_51{display:flex;align-items:center;gap:16px}._socials_12hgp_51 a{display:inline-flex;align-items:center;justify-content:center;width:42px;height:42px;border-radius:999px;color:#000;text-decoration:none;font-size:1.4rem;border:1px solid rgba(0,0,0,.18);transition:background .2s ease,transform .15s ease}._socials_12hgp_51 a:hover{background:#0000000f;transform:translateY(-1px)}._right_12hgp_76{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:clamp(20px,3vw,48px)}@media(max-width:600px){._right_12hgp_76{grid-template-columns:1fr}}._column_12hgp_87{display:flex;flex-direction:column;gap:12px}._columnTitle_12hgp_93{font-weight:800;font-size:.95rem;letter-spacing:.04em;text-transform:uppercase}._link_12hgp_100{color:#000;text-decoration:none;opacity:.8;font-size:.95rem;transition:opacity .2s ease,transform .15s ease}._link_12hgp_100:hover{opacity:1;transform:translate(2px)}._bottomBar_12hgp_113{border-top:1px solid rgba(0,0,0,.12);padding:20px clamp(80px,14vw,160px);font-size:.9rem;opacity:.75}._fadeSection_1tky5_1{opacity:0;transform:translateY(14px);transition:opacity .6s ease,transform .6s ease;will-change:opacity,transform}._in_1tky5_8{opacity:1;transform:translateY(0)}._out_1tky5_13{opacity:0;transform:translateY(14px)}@media(prefers-reduced-motion:reduce){._fadeSection_1tky5_1{transition:none;transform:none}._in_1tky5_8,._out_1tky5_13{opacity:1}}
